Запитання з тегом «postgresql»

PostgreSQL - це об'єктно-реляційна система баз даних з відкритим кодом.

1
Різниця між SpatialJoin з "… де…" та "приєднатись… по…"
Цікаво, де різниця між цими двома просторовими з'єднаннями, і, якщо є різниця, коли використовувати. SELECT * FROM points p, shapes s WHERE ST_Within(p.geom, s.geom); і SELECT * FROM points p INNER JOIN shapes s ON ST_Within(p.geom, s.geom) Чи швидше один у певних ситуаціях?

1
Використовуйте тип даних масиву [] в QGIS від PostgreSQL
Я просто початківець в ГІС, тому буду радий побачити тут будь-який коментар. У мене є PostgreSQL таблиці, які я підключив до QGIS. У таблицях із типом даних є стовпці array[]. Але користувачам нелегко вставляти дані в стовпчик, використовуючи такий вид {a, d, c}. Чи є простий спосіб редагування даних? У …

1
Чи можна копіювати базу даних геоданих SDE, включаючи архівні таблиці?
У мене є база даних в одному місці, яку я хотів би повторити в іншу, використовуючи односторонню реплікацію. Під час тестування нам не вдалося повторити архівні таблиці, що шкода, оскільки нам потрібно зберігати ці історичні версії в обох місцях. Чи можна просто копіювати всю базу даних DEFAULT (включаючи таблиці архівів). …

2
Як ST_Split функції в одній таблиці за особливостями в іншій?
Мені потрібно розділити багатокутники (шар 'pol') на закриті та не закриті рядки (шар 'lin'). На жаль, я не отримую належних результатів за допомогою наступного запиту. CREATE VIEW splitted_pol AS SELECT g.path[1] as gid, g.geom::geometry(polygon, SRID) as geom FROM (SELECT (ST_Dump(ST_Split(pol.geom, lin.geom))).* FROM pol, lin ) as g; У моєму прикладі …

3
Як перетворити ізоліни на ізополігони з постгітами?
У мене є таблиця постгігів ізоліній, яка визначена так: CREATE TABLE myisolines ( gid serial NOT NULL, isotime timestamp without timezone, val numeric(10,4), geom geometry(LineString,4326) ); Візуально цей об'єкт рядкових рядків виглядає приблизно так: Я знаю просторовий обсяг моїх даних, тому я можу додати Bbox, тому LineStrings може бути як …

2
Як обчислити відстань на Манхеттені за допомогою PostGIS?
Я використовую функцію ST_Distance, щоб обчислити відстань між двома геометріями (залізнична станція та будівля). Оскільки я знаю, що всі будівлі та всі залізничні станції знаходяться в Чикаго, який має чудову / повну сітку вулиць, я хотів би використовувати Манхеттен (або такси) відстань . Загальною формулою для цього є різниця в …

1
Обчислити графік видимості по сфері
У мене є таблиця PostGIS з деякими багатокутниками (зберігається з використанням типу даних географії). Вони представляють регіони на сферичній землі. Для кожної пари вершин, вибраних серед усіх многокутників, я хочу обчислити, чи є ці дві вершини "видимими" один для одного. (Є n * ( n -1) / 2 таких пар, …

2
Встановіть дані PostGIS та TIGER в Ubuntu 12.04
Чи може хтось написати короткий, хоч і схильний керівництво ідіотів щодо встановлення постгітів та завантаження національних даних про тигра на ubuntu? Я спробував декілька посібників, а саме http://wiki.bitnami.com/@api/deki/pages/302/pdf , але мені не пощастило. Прошу вибачення за відкритий характер цього питання.

2
Які програмно-програмні засоби управління графічним інтерфейсом існують для PostgreSQL / PostGIS?
Більшість мого досвіду роботи з PostgreSQL були pgAdminIII та psql, але мені цікаво знати, що використовують інші. Чи існує PostgreSQL, еквівалентний студії управління SQL Server (SSMS) та його здатністю обмежено відображати результати, що містять геометрію (безкоштовно або платно)? Або більшість людей просто запускають GIS-клієнт збоку для цієї мети, оскільки це …

1
Продуктивність при обчисленні растрової статистики в PostGIS
Я намагаюся обчислити растрову статистику (хв, макс, середнє) для кожного багатокутника у векторному шарі, використовуючи PostgreSQL / PostGIS. Ця відповідь GIS.SE описує, як це зробити, обчисливши перетин між полігоном та растром, а потім обчисливши середньозважене значення: https://gis.stackexchange.com/a/19858/12420 Я використовую наступний запит (де demмій растр, topo_area_su_regionмій вектор та toidунікальний ідентифікатор: SELECT …


3
Помилка PostGIS: не вдалося завантажити бібліотеку “/usr/lib/postgresql91/lib64/postgis-2.0.so”
ОС відкритаSUSE 12.1, PostgreSQL - 9.1, PostGIS - 2.0. Postgre / PostGIS встановлюються з Application: Geo сховища. Після останніх оновлень, коли я намагаюся підключитися до своєї бази даних, я отримую таку помилку: ERROR: could not load library "/usr/lib/postgresql91/lib64/postgis-2.0.so": /usr/lib/postgresql91/lib64/postgis-2.0.so: undefined symbol: pj_get_spheroid_defn Я шукав в Інтернеті цю помилку ( підказка-1 …

2
Найкраща конструкція для прототипу Open Source Python / PostGIS
Я пишу веб-додаток, що інтенсивно використовує дані, що постачається через apache. Моє запитання - як найкраще організувати обробку, враховуючи, що існує кілька варіантів. У мене в розпорядженні OpenLayers / JQuery / Javascript, PostGIS / Postgresql (з pgsql), python / psycopg2, php. База даних містить близько 3 мільйонів рядків, і прототип …

1
Як переглянути растр розміром 155 Мб, що зберігається в PostGIS?
Я використовую таку команду для завантаження растра в базу даних postgres: raster2pgsql -I -C -e -Y -F -s 3086 -I -C -M myraster.tif myraster -F -t 30x30 | psql -U postgres -d database -h localhost -p 5432 myraster.tifстановить 155М. Коли я намагаюся використовувати растровий плагін у QGIS, завантажувати потрібно дуже …

1
Використовуєте PostgreSQL з QGIS та ArcGIS?
Чи можливо використовувати PostgreSQL з QGIS та ArcGIS? тобто одна база даних для різних клієнтів. Чи є щось, що я хвилююся чи якісь проблеми використовувати СУБД з двох різних програм? Я знаю, що мені потрібні PostGIS і ArcSDE, і я не можу маніпулювати або зберігати растрові дані з PostGIS 1.5 …

Використовуючи наш веб-сайт, ви визнаєте, що прочитали та зрозуміли наші Політику щодо файлів cookie та Політику конфіденційності.
Licensed under cc by-sa 3.0 with attribution required.